Overview: The recent Wall School Board meeting was marked by a tribute to Superintendent Dr. Tracy Handerhan, who announced her retirement after six years of service. The board and community members expressed their deep appreciation for her leadership and the progress achieved during her tenure. Dr. Handerhan’s contributions were highlighted by improvements in educational programs, infrastructure, and community relations within the district.

Overview: In a recent meeting of the Wall Township Public School District Board of Education, discussions included the approval of a Navy Junior Reserve Officers Training Corps (NJROTC) unit, concerns about school bus safety, and the celebration of local student achievements. The board addressed the possible impact of these initiatives on the community, particularly in terms of enhanced educational opportunities and student safety.

Overview: During the recent Wall Township Board of Education meeting, attention was focused on public support for Coach Rogers amid his ongoing disciplinary review, as well as discussions surrounding the upcoming school budget, particularly concerning health benefits. The meeting saw testimonies from community members regarding Rogers, while the budget presentation highlighted a proposed tax increase and detailed financial allocations.

Overview: The Wall Township Board of Education meeting on March 10, 2026, primarily focused on the district’s upcoming budget and the introduction of innovative programs, most notably the RISE program, designed to support students with anxiety and school phobia. The meeting also addressed technology improvements, the curriculum and instruction budget, and the district’s financial planning for health benefits and transportation.
